20080239982 | METHOD FOR MONITORING IMPULSE NOISE - In a network for digital data packet transmission, quality records are stored in a memory. Each of the quality records is indicative for a reception quality being sensed of one or more received data packets. Thereupon, upon overflow of the memory, one or more of the quality records is discarded from the memory. For at least one of the quality records, discarding weights are generated as a function of at least one of the quality records and associated to the quality records. Hereby, upon such overflow, the discarding weights are taken into account in predefined rules and conditions according to which the discarding of the quality records is performed. | 10-02-2008 |
20120057693 | Joint Signal Processing Across A Plurality Of Line Termination Cards - In one embodiment, the line termination card includes a data output terminal configured to output a data sequence. The card further includes a vectoring entity configured to parse and encode the data sequence into frequency samples according to a carrier loading parameter, configured to scale the frequency samples into scaled frequency samples according to a carrier scaling parameter, and, configured to process the scaled frequency samples for crosstalk compensation. A controller is configured to adjust the carrier loading parameter and the carrier scaling parameter, and a forwarder is coupled to the data output terminal and to the controller. The forwarder is configured to forward the data sequence, the carrier loading parameter and the carrier scaling parameter towards a further line termination card. | 03-08-2012 |

20130301824 | CROSSTALK CANCELLATION DEVICE AND METHOD WITH IMPROVED VECTORING STABILISATION - A crosstalk cancellation device cancels crosstalk noise of at most M disturbing communication lines in a victim communication line forming part of a vectoring group. The crosstalk cancellation device gradually decreases the cancellation depth of a cancelled disturbing communication line in the victim communication line upon a crosstalk noise variation in the vectoring group requiring cancellation of crosstalk noise of a not yet cancelled disturbing communication line in the victim communication line. | 11-14-2013 |
20140241378 | HIERARCHICAL AND ADAPTIVE MULTI-CARRIER DIGITAL MODULATION AND DEMODULATION - In an embodiment the method includes, at a transmit side, grouping carriers into carrier groups, and selecting a group constellation diagram for modulation of the carriers of a given carrier group. The selected group constellation diagram is built as a hierarchical sum of I super-imposed constellations vectors having predefined decreasing powers with the P strongest and the Q weakest constellation vectors being omitted. The carriers of the carrier group are modulated by means of the selected group constellation diagram, and P and/or Q parameters per carrier group and per multi-carrier data symbol are adjusted. | 08-28-2014 |
20140247900 | DATA RETRANSMISSION REQUEST DEVICE, A DATA TRANSMITTER, AND A DATA RETRANSMISSION METHOD FOR MULTI-TONE SYSTEMS - In a multi-tone data transmission system, data are modulated on a set of M tones for being transmitted between a transmitter and a receiver. The data retransmission request device in such system is adapted to request retransmission of a data transmission unit that is hierarchically modulated at a particular hierarchical level and that is modulated on a particular group of N tones, N being a positive integer value greater than one and smaller than or equal to M. | 09-04-2014 |
20140376604 | POWER ADAPTATION AVOIDANCE DURING CROSSTALK MEASUREMENTS - In one embodiment, the access node includes a vectoring control unit for estimating crosstalk coefficients between a set of subscriber lines based on crosstalk measurements carried out over the set of subscriber lines during a crosstalk measurement phase, and a vectoring processing unit for jointly processing, for crosstalk mitigation, signals to be transmitted over, or received from, the set of subscriber lines based on the estimated crosstalk coefficients. The access node further includes a controller configured to either postpone the execution of power adaptation over a particular line out of the set of subscriber lines after the completion of the crosstalk measurement phase, or to postpone the crosstalk measurement phase after the completion of power adaptation over the particular line. | 12-25-2014 |
20150063560 | METHODS AND SYSTEMS FOR ACTIVATING AND DEACTIVATING COMMUNICATION PATHS - At least one example embodiment discloses a method of initializing a plurality of communication paths in a system. The method includes obtaining a first matrix from a storage medium, the first matrix including at least one channel sub-matrix of the system associated with a subset of the plurality of communication paths, obtaining an indication of which communication paths are to become active and determining, after the obtaining the indication, new compensation coefficients based on the at least one channel sub-matrix and active compensation coefficients, the active compensation coefficients for compensating for crosstalk between the active communication paths prior to the number of active communication paths changing. | 03-05-2015 |
